150 Camden Street has a Walk Score of 97 out of 100. This location is a Walker’s Paradise so daily errands do not require a car.
150 Camden Street is a three minute walk from the Orange Line at the Massachusetts Avenue stop.
This location is in the Lower Roxbury neighborhood in Boston. Nearby parks include Frederick Douglass Green, WM E Carter Baseball Fields and WM E Carter Courts.
